a park is 4 times as long as it is wide. if the distance around the park is 12.5 kilometers, what is the area of the park?

So, first, what are the two sides?

let's call then x and y

we know that 2(x+y)=12.5 (that's the distance around)

so that means that x+y=6.25 (I just divided both by 2)

now, x=4y (from "4 times as long as it is wide")

so we can substitute:

x+4x=6.25

5x=6.25

x=1.25

so one side, is 1.25 and the other will be 1.25*4=5

and for the area we multiply the two:

1.25*5=6.25 square kilometers, and this is the answer!

The Area of the park is 6.25 square kilometers.

  • Let the wide = X
  • The length = 4X (the length is 4 times long as it is wide)
<h2>Further Explanation</h2>

Therefore, we should have:

To determine the perimeter of the rectangle = 2 x (length + wide)

P = 2 (L + W)

P = 2L + 2W

Recall the distance around the park is 12.5,

Hence,

= 12.5 = 2 (4x) + 2 (x)

= 12.5 = 8x + 2x

= 12.5 = 10x

X = \frac{12.5}{10}

X = 1.25

To determine the area, the formula for area is (A = W x L )

A = X x (4X)

A = 4X^{2}

A = 4 x (1.25)^{2}

A = 4 x (1.25 x 1.25)

A = 4 x 1.5625

A = 6.25 square kilometers

Thus, the area of the park is 6.25 square kilometers.
